  • How to keep engine clean? Is flushing the engine safe? After how many km should engine flushing be done? Disadvantages of engine flushing? How to flush an engine? Engine flush quantity?Which is the best engine flush? and a lot more questions which we try to answer in this video.
    This video is a basic tutorial on how to flush an engine. Here we have used the Dominar 400 and the same process is applicable to the most of the motorcycle engines from TVS, BAJAJ, HONDA, SUZUKI, HERO etc for flushing.
    This time we have changed the engine oil on the Dominar 400 and have switched to Liqui Moly street race 10w50 grade fully synthetic engine oil.
